After getting picked up at your hotel in the city centre, you will leave Tromsø behind you and head to Kvaløya (“Whale Island”), where you will visit some of the most beautiful landmarks that make Tromsø one of Norway’s most popular destinations. There are often reindeer and elk crossing the road, and you might spot sea eagles and seals hunting for fish. From mid October to late January, whales visit Tromsø’s fjords to feed on herring. During that time there is a good chance you will spot humpback whales and orcas from the shore. You will have a light lunch and hot drinks around a campfire.
